莉凡网

linux 查看文件夹大小列表

放牛AI工具

Linux 查看文件夹大小列表:使用命令行工具轻松管理文件空间

在 Linux 系统中,查看文件夹大小列表是一项重要的任务,它可以帮助用户了解文件空间的使用情况,从而更好地管理和优化存储资源。本文将介绍几种常用的命令行工具,帮助您轻松查看和管理文件夹大小列表。

1. 使用 du 命令

du(disk usage)命令是 Linux 系统中用于查看文件和文件夹空间占用情况的常用工具。通过 du 命令,您可以轻松查看指定目录下的文件夹大小列表。

基本语法如下:

du -h --max-depth=1 /path/to/directory

其中,-h 选项表示以易读的格式显示文件大小,--max-depth=1 选项表示递归深度为 1,即只显示目录及其直接子目录的大小。

2. 使用 ncdu 命令

ncdu(NCurses Disk Usage)是一个基于文本的用户界面工具,用于查看和管理文件空间占用情况。与 du 命令相比,ncdu 提供了更为直观的图形界面,方便用户查看文件夹大小列表。

首先,您需要安装 ncdu 工具。在大多数 Linux 发行版中,您可以使用包管理器进行安装,例如在 Ubuntu 系统中:

sudo apt-get install ncdu

安装完成后,运行以下命令即可查看指定目录的文件夹大小列表:

ncdu /path/to/directory

3. 使用 find 命令

除了 du 和 ncdu 命令外,您还可以使用 find 命令结合其他工具来查看文件夹大小列表。find 命令可以帮助您查找符合特定条件的文件和文件夹,然后使用 xargs 命令将结果传递给其他工具进行处理。

以下是一个示例命令,用于查找指定目录下的所有文件夹,并计算它们的大小:

find /path/to/directory -type d -exec du -h {} +

在这个命令中,-type d 选项表示查找目录,-exec 选项后面跟 du 命令和要处理的文件或文件夹。+ 符号表示将所有找到的结果作为参数传递给 du 命令。

4. 使用磁盘分析器

除了命令行工具外,您还可以使用图形界面的磁盘分析器来查看文件夹大小列表。许多 Linux 发行版都预装了一些磁盘分析器,如 Baobab(GNOME)、SpaceFM(XFCE)等。这些工具提供了直观的图形界面,方便用户查看和管理文件空间。

以 Baobab 为例,您可以在文件管理器中直接打开一个目录,然后点击“打开终端”并输入:

baobab

这将打开 Baobab 磁盘分析器,并显示当前目录的文件夹大小列表。您可以在图形界面中轻松查看和分析文件空间占用情况。

5. 结论

查看和管理文件夹大小列表是 Linux 用户的一项重要任务。通过本文介绍的命令行工具和图形界面工具,您可以轻松地了解文件空间的使用情况,并根据需要进行优化。希望这些方法能帮助您更好地管理 Linux 系统中的文件空间。

放牛AI工具

本文链接:https://www.hello-linux.com/linux/45633.html

版权声明:本网站内容均来源于网络,如涉及侵权,请联系作者!

发表评论

还没有评论,快来说点什么吧~

联系客服
公众号
公众号
公众号
返回顶部